November 18, 1942.
Present — Crosby, P.J., Taylor, Dowling, Harris and McCurn, JJ.
Order reversed in so far as it denies the motion for an examination before trial on the question of undue influence, without costs of this appeal to either party, and motion granted to that extent, without costs, and matter remitted to the Surrogate's Court to fix the date and place of the examination and the period to be covered thereby, and otherwise order affirmed without costs. Appeal from the order denying motion for a reargument dismissed as academic. All concur. (One order denies objectant's motion for an examination of proponent before trial; the second order denies a reargument of the motion.)
